One of FBI’s most wanted arrested in Mt. Pleasant area

A 47-year-old male from Albania sought in connection with organized crime was recently arrested near Mt. Pleasant Road and Eglinton Avenue by officers of the Toronto Police Service Fugitive Squad.

Kujtim ‘Jimmy’ Lika was wanted by the FBI’s Newark, N.J., office for his alleged involvement in a high profile case that has appeared on America’s Most Wanted. Lika is believed to have been an accomplice to Myfit ‘Mike’ Dika, who was arrested in Toronto in 2010. Dika was alleged to have been involved in an international conspiracy to traffic drugs and firearms, as well as launder money.
